⭐ Vegetable Oil (Best Gluten-Free Option)
1 tablespoon per 1 cup of cooked riceVegetable oil is a refined oil with a high smoke point (around 400°F/204°C), which is essential for the quick, high-heat cooking method used in fried rice. Its neutral flavor does not interfere with the other ingredients, allowing the natural flavors of soy sauce, vegetables, and aromatics to shine.
To ensure success, heat the oil until shimmering but not smoking before adding ingredients to prevent sticking and ensure even cooking. Avoid overheating to maintain oil stability.
Compared to coconut oil, vegetable oil lacks the subtle coconut aroma but provides a similarly effective fat medium for frying, maintaining the desired texture and mouthfeel of fried rice.
